Overview

The Agela FLEXA HP50 is a modular, high-pressure preparative liquid chromatography (prep-LC) system engineered for reproducible, scalable purification of small molecules, natural products, peptides, and synthetic intermediates in research and early-development laboratories. Built on a robust dual-piston reciprocating pump architecture, it delivers stable gradient elution and precise flow control up to 30 MPa (4350 psi), enabling compatibility with both conventional silica-based and high-efficiency superficially porous (core-shell) prep columns (e.g., 10–50 mm ID, 5–25 µm particle sizes). Unlike analytical HPLC systems, the FLEXA HP50 is optimized for mass-based fraction collection—not just detection—supporting method transfer from analytical to preparative scale via retention time and selectivity mapping. Its open-system design allows seamless integration with third-party detectors (UV-Vis, MS, ELSD) and fraction collectors, making it suitable for orthogonal purification workflows under GLP-aligned laboratory practices.

Key Features

  • Modular Architecture: Interchangeable, plug-and-play modules—including dual-gradient high-pressure pumps, variable-wavelength UV/Vis detector (190–800 nm), six-port/ten-port column switchers, refrigerated fraction collector (4°C–25°C), and optional autosampler—enable configuration tailored to throughput, resolution, and compound stability requirements.
  • Precision Fluid Handling: Dual-piston pump with active solvent compressibility compensation ensures ≤±1% RSD flow accuracy across the full 0.1–50 mL/min range, critical for maintaining consistent loading capacity and peak shape during multi-gram purifications.
  • High-Pressure Capability: Rated for continuous operation at 30 MPa, supporting sub-5 µm particle columns and elevated mobile phase velocities without backpressure-induced system instability or seal wear.
  • Intuitive Control Interface: Touchscreen console with embedded method editor supports gradient programming (up to 10-step linear or step gradients), real-time pressure/flow monitoring, and event-triggered fraction collection based on UV threshold, time window, or peak apex detection.
  • Chemical Compatibility: Fluidic path constructed from 316L stainless steel, PEEK, and sapphire components resists corrosion from aggressive solvents (e.g., THF, DCM, TFA, high-pH ammonium bicarbonate), ensuring long-term reliability and minimal carryover.

Sample Compatibility & Compliance

The FLEXA HP50 accommodates sample loads ranging from milligram to multi-gram quantities per injection, depending on column dimensions and stationary phase chemistry. It supports reversed-phase (C18, C8, phenyl-hexyl), normal-phase (silica, cyano), and ion-exchange media. All hardware and firmware comply with ISO 9001 manufacturing standards. Data acquisition and method storage meet basic ALCOA+ principles (Attributable, Legible, Contemporaneous, Original, Accurate); optional software add-ons provide 21 CFR Part 11-compliant electronic signatures, audit trails, and user access controls for regulated environments. The system is routinely validated per ASTM E2656 (Standard Practice for Validation of Prep-LC Systems) and aligns with ICH Q5A/Q5B guidance for biopharmaceutical impurity isolation.

Software & Data Management

Control and data handling are managed via Agela’s FLEXA Control Suite v3.2—a Windows-based application supporting method import/export (CSV, XML), real-time chromatogram overlay, peak integration using tangent skim or valley-to-valley algorithms, and customizable fraction mapping. Raw data files (.agd) are stored with embedded metadata (operator ID, timestamp, instrument serial, method checksum). Export options include AIA/ANDI-compliant .cdf files for third-party processing (e.g., Chromeleon, Empower), as well as PDF reports with integrated calibration curves and system suitability test (SST) summaries. Local database archiving supports version-controlled method libraries and retrospective batch traceability.

FAQ

What column formats are compatible with the FLEXA HP50?
Standard 1/4″ and 1/8″ stainless steel or PEEK tubing connections support columns from 10 mm to 50 mm internal diameter; guard cartridges and in-line filters are recommended for extended column lifetime.

Can the system be operated remotely or integrated into a lab automation network?
Yes—Ethernet port enables remote desktop access and OPC UA server integration for centralized fleet monitoring and scheduling within LIMS or MES platforms.

Is method transfer support available from analytical to preparative scale?
The system includes built-in scaling calculators that adjust flow rate, injection volume, and gradient slope based on column geometry and particle size ratios, facilitating direct translation of UHPLC methods.

What maintenance intervals are recommended for routine operation?
Pump seals require replacement every 6–12 months depending on solvent aggressiveness; UV lamp life is rated at ≥2000 hours; annual performance verification (pressure accuracy, flow precision, gradient composition) is advised per ISO/IEC 17025 guidelines.
